Turkish class! Fenerbahce fans pay tribute to Rangers supporter killed in Istanbul at Glasgow airport ahead of Europa League showdown

    Supporters of Fenerbahce have shown remarkable solidarity by paying tribute to Christopher Potter, the Rangers fan who tragically lost his life in Istanbul. Potter, a devoted Rangers supporter, had travelled to Turkey to watch his team compete but was killed in a road accident. His unexpected passing deeply affected the Rangers community and football fans worldwide, prompting an outpouring of support and remembrance.

    During the first-leg match in Istanbul, Rangers players wore black armbands as a mark of respect for Potter. Back in Dennistoun, the neighbourhood where Potter grew up, a memorial wall has been created in his honour. The tribute site is situated near the football pitch and playground where he spent much of his childhood. A GoFundMe campaign set up by Potter’s close friends has been met with overwhelming generosity, surpassing £160,000 in donations. Among those contributing was former Scotland international Robert Snodgrass, who made a personal donation in support of Potter’s family.

    Adding to the wave of tributes, travelling Fenerbahce fans made their own heartfelt gesture. A group of supporters posed for a photograph with a specially made flag honouring the late Rangers fan. The banner featured an image of Potter holding a Rangers scarf, accompanied by the words: "Rest in Peace. Christopher Potter. Fenerbahce London Association."

    As Rangers and Fenerbahce prepare to face off once again on Thursday, March 6, the atmosphere is expected to be filled with remembrance and reflection. For Rangers, the match will not just be about defending their 3-1 lead but also about honouring a passionate fan who will no longer be cheering from the stands.
